#7cee63 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7cee63 is composed of 48.6% red, 93.3%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 58.4%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 109.2 degrees, a saturation of 80.3% and a lightness of 66.1%. #7cee63 color hex could be obtained by blending #f8ffc6 with #00dd00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

#7cee63 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7cee63 has RGB values of R:124, G:238,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.58,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 8187491.
